The Afghan Future Fund and No One Left Behind are proud to announce the launch of the America’s Allies Scholarship Program (AASP).
AASP is a landmark initiative to provide financial assistance on a competitive basis to Afghan and Iraqi translators and interpreters who served with U.S. Armed Forces, enabling them to pursue a college degree or professional training in the United States.
AWARD
​Each AASP awardee will receive support in the form of a one-time grant of up to $20,000 to be used for qualifying academic expenses, including four-year or two-year college degrees, vocational training, or other educational and training programs in the United States.
ELIGIBILITY
-
Special Immigrant Visa (SIV) holder from Afghanistan or Iraq
-
Previously served as a translator or interpreter
-
Currently living in the United States
-
Enrolled in or applying to an accredited educational or training program in the United States
Deadline: May 31, 2025
Applications will be accepted on a rolling basis until May 31, 2025, to support students during the 2025 – 2026 academic year. Applications will be evaluated based on merit, need, and materials submitted for review.
